E rosettes


<haematology> The clustering of sheep erythrocytes around a leucocyte or other cell. E rosette formation is used as a marker for T lymphocytes of humans and most mammals, in this case erythrocytes are untreated, compared with other rosette tests such as EA where erythrocytes have antibody bound to their surface.
